Transaction 0871139f1d5976c8954127584a8329f74dee463fa0f72a6fc19e53db69f51e0d

1 Input
2 Outputs
  • 0871139f1d5976c8954127584a8329f74dee463fa0f72a6fc19e53db69f51e0d:0
  • value  18740
    address  1CkVgHxM4hPfJ8cXTSQEYyryKQfFSvKp4s
  • 0871139f1d5976c8954127584a8329f74dee463fa0f72a6fc19e53db69f51e0d:1
  • value  75402
    address  1A6KkLHoCM4YLNg7XVe87Qgf8dLMSRLCKF